Her

Her

She's drawn to the dark, as the moon has her in a trance.

Her body sways to the rythym of the storm.

She lifts her arms as she embraces the rain.

The thunder illuminates her spirit and lightning brightens her eyes.

She is one with herself as she gets lost in the ecstasy she calls Her abyss...
